Output 990ae847a4d499c073680ac82496e7e21a9e527172c844b40ac29a90956b7d1f:0

value
25548442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9993ae393912885228d1287be3f75fdd9c936ee4 OP_EQUAL
address
3Fh4DvFwM1PsVuAAVhScMb9bNnFJj7uXsh
transaction
990ae847a4d499c073680ac82496e7e21a9e527172c844b40ac29a90956b7d1f
confirmations
390382
spent
true